  ATC 9180 - I thought this was the South African release but I have been informed that it is the Rhodesian release as it has white labels - Manufactured by TEAL Record Company. I do not know too much about it other than I bought it at a record fair and was told it is South African so please take a look at the photos for the actual item.   It is marked 'Superhype' and there is a misprint 'I Can't Quite you Baby' on the label   The record is in excellent condition with no scratches or jumps but there is some very slight crackling in places - it has been stored on a shelf in a plastic sleeve for a long time so it could just be a little dusty.   The sleeve is in good condition apart from a small tear on the open side as you should see from the photos.

I have received this helpful info from another Ebay member: Hi. It's definitely the Rhodesian pressing - I own all the Zep South African pressings and 4 Rhodesian pressings (plus releases from Angola and Mozambique) including this one, as well as singles from these countries. Teal Records was the leading record manufacturer in Southern Africa (along with Trutone) and had the Atlantic license for most territories, so people look up up Teal and assume South Africa as it was based there, but each territory has slightly different releases.
